Issue

  • Currently, it's only possible to find and select related files in a Web Content by searching by name. This becomes impractical when dealing with thousand of files that don't have semantic names but are well-structured in folders and subfolders.
  • Is there any configuration where I can change this through the folder and subfolder hierarchy defined in Documents and media?  

Environment

  • All environments

Resolution

  • Right now this is a limitation on the product. There is a Feature Request asking to include this functionality in a future release of Liferay: LPD-26295
